- To Add a book for sharing do:-
PUT /api/v1/booky/
- To Browse the shared books do:-
GET /api/v1/booky/
- To borrow a book for certain duration of time do:-
PUT /api/v1/booky/<book_id>/borrow
- book_id -> ID of the Book that has been added for sharing with others
- borrow_start_time -> Start Time from when the Book is being borrowed
- borrow_end_time -> End Time till when the Book is being borrowed (a week).
- To view all the borrowed books:-
GET /api/v1/booky/borrow
- To return a borrowed book do:-
POST /api/v1/booky/<book_id>/borrow/<borrow_id>
- book_id -> ID of the Book that has been added for sharing with others
- borrow_id -> ID of the Borrow operation for Book with book_id
- Start By cloning the repository:-
git clone [email protected]:2k4sm/share_book.git
- Change directory to the cloned repository:-
cd share_book
- Download dependencies using the go mod file:-
go mod tidy
- To build the server do:-
go build cmd/web/server.go
- To start the server do:-
From the root directory of share_book.
./server
- Use curl/hoppscotch/postman to test the API.
